90.61 percent of the population in 76092 drive to work alone. 0.63 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 53.55 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 5.25 percent of the residents in 76092 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 3.19 members with about 2.35 cars available per household.
An estimate of 94.85 percent of the residents in 76092 has some form of health insurance. 13.99 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 89.08 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 76092 would have to travel an average of 0.87 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Texas Health Harris Methodist Hospital Southlake .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 76092, Southlake, Texas.

As of , an estimate of 31,276 residents live in 76092 with a median age of 42.0 years. 33.07 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 11.12 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 44.88 percent of the residents in 76092 is currently married, and 11.44 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 76092 is $20,833.42.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 76092 is approximately $3,419. The median household spends about 16.41 percent of their income on housing.
